(11/20) Women Are More in Favor of Censorship and More Likely to Falsely Believe the Government Has Hate Speech Laws We found that women are more inclined than men to want to prevent people from believing, saying, and doing what they want (see graph below on the left). With respect to online political discourse specifically, we found that older women were particularly favorable to censorship (see graph below on top right). Women, in general, were also more likely than men to believe, incorrectly, that the US government has laws against "hate speech" (see graph below on bottom right). Illinois Store Owner Sentenced to 46-month Imprisonment and Ordered to Pay Over $560,000 in Restitution for Fraudulent SNAP Benefits Scheme: justice.gov/usao-sdil/pr/c… “Illinois SNAP recipients were for years ripped off by this criminal who used his store, Egyptian Corner, to steal from them,” said USDA Inspector General John Walk. “Instead of using his Food and Nutrition Administration SNAP retailer authorization to provide eligible food to needy Illinois residents, the convict took federal reimbursement for selling unlawful items and laundered SNAP benefits through other retail locations to enrich himself. USDA OIG special agents went to work with federal partners and now he’ll do the time – 46 months in federal prison, 3 years of supervised release, $564,936.19 in restitution, and $489,936.18 forfeited. Working with VP Vance and WH Task Force to Eliminate Fraud, USDA OIG will do the work to send fraudsters in Illinois or anywhere else to prison.”
